## Changelog — Graindock 4.2

Default table partitioning is now by month, not quarter. Plugins that assume quarterly partition names will break; use the partition resolver API instead of string templates. Existing tables are not repartitioned automatically — run the migration tool before upgrading. Retention sweeps now run per-partition, so drop hooks fire more often. The new defaults shipped with this release are as follows.

service settings:
wenath:
  log_level: debug
  metrics_host: metrics.wenath.tolvaqlabs.internal
  pool_size: 4

Headcount Plan — Next Fiscal Year (Managers Only)
Orrin Fabrication Group

Total approved headcount rises from 412 to 441. Growth is concentrated in the Delvane plant (14 roles) and quality engineering (9 roles). Corporate functions remain flat; attrition backfills need director sign-off. Finance should load these figures into the Q1 forecast model by month-end. Contractor conversions are capped at six. The strategic rationale is summarized in the note below.

confidential, hahop-bajep: Gross margin on Ralath came in at 5 percent against a plan of 10 percent. Only 9 of the 100 pilot accounts renewed Ralath, so a churn review is set for April 1.

## Service Accounts — StormFan Alert Fan-Out

The fan-out worker authenticates to the internal dispatch tier using the svc-stormfan account. Rotate quarterly; scopes are limited to publish-only on alert topics. If deliveries stall during your shift, verify the worker is using the current credential, reproduced below for reference.

API key for kaweg-hahif: kto4_rAjZ